Default F20B swap help!

Hey I did an F20b swap in my 99 civic hatch, first swap I've ever done but had a few buddies help me along the way. Anyways its getting its fuel but no fire, sparkplugs not firing when i test them. When I took the cap off there was a little bit of oil in there which im assuming is from a bad seal? I have never had to mess with distributors before but i did research and tested different points there was no spark at the coil so I put one off an h22 (same numbers on both, looked identical) and still nothing. I know this may seem vague or like a stupid question but I don't know what else to do and have spent so much along the way it would be cool if i didn't have to buy a whole new distributor especially if that might not even work, I know theres some smart people out there with experience, any help at all would be greatly appreciated really wanna get this thing kicking again, thanks
